What is Ceramic Lube?

Ben Noll

Ceramic lubes are synthetic or wax-based lubricant that is infused with little nanoparticles of boron nitride. These particles embed themselves onto the chain, displacing dirt buildup. With additional applications of the ceramic lube, a coating will form that protects the chain from dirt and performance wear. Ceramic lube also comes in both dry and wet versions for various riding conditions although it is worth noting that because of the coating even the dry lube will be more resistant to be washed off than standard dry lube.
